什么语言编写的程序运行速度最快,请问在各种计算机语言中那种语言执行速度最快

1,请问在各种计算机语言中那种语言执行速度最快针对性调优过的汇编速度是最快的 。所有的语言最终都到汇编汇编再到机器语言 。语言编译的时候都有优化 , 所以好的汇编是最快的 。但是差的汇编也不少MSP430上的程序都有一个判断执行15秒的(上学的时候我写的 哈哈) 。所以,调优过的汇编是最快的 。不过一般计算机语言都不算汇编的所以还是C吧,这个不得不说最好用了,也最快了 。当然是汇编!
2,在各类程序设计语言中相比较而言执行效率最高的是程序设计语言中汇编语言速度最快,c语言效率最高,执行效率高 。C语言的设计目标是提供一种能以简易的方式编译、处理低级存储器、仅产生少量的机器码以及不需要任何运行环境支持便能运行的编程语言 。C语言描述问题比汇编语言迅速,工作量小、可读性好,易于调试、修改和移植,而代码质量与汇编语言相当 。C语言一般只比汇编语言代码生成的目标程序效率低10%~20% 。因此 , C语言可以编写系统软件 。扩展资料:C语言缺点:1、 C语言的缺点主要表现在数据的封装性上,这一点使得C在数据的安全性上有很大缺陷,这也是C和C++的一大区别 。2、 C语言的语法限制不太严格,对变量的类型约束不严格,影响程序的安全性,对数组下标越界不作检查等 。从应用的角度 , C语言比其他高级语言较难掌握 。也就是说 , 对用C语言的人,要求对程序设计更熟练一些 。
3,哪一种C语言编写的程序运行速度最快C语言只有一种 , 不过同一个C程序在不同的编译器中编译出来的结果是不一样的 。速度我没做过比较 , 我想是和编译器的优化策略有关,选用“速度最优”的策略会比默认的"体积最小"要快吧 。如果你需要加快程序的运行速度,把最占用时间的那些代码改用汇编来编写,另外可以考虑采用多线程 , 可以达到不错的效果 。程序运行的快慢和语言没有太大的关系,关键是程序本身算法决定速度 , 哈哈 。你这个程序,没必要进行速度测试,因为他的指针和跳转简直是太少了,并且谈不上什么算法 。【什么语言编写的程序运行速度最快,请问在各种计算机语言中那种语言执行速度最快】
4 , 编程语言哪个速度快编程语言Pascal和VB速度快 。学习编程的作用:1、辅助工作 。当前正外在大数据时代背景下,对于职场人来说,掌握一定的数据分析技术将是未来一个发展趋势,而无论是采用统计学的数据分析方式还是机器学习的数据分析方式 , 编程都是重要的工具 。目前在金融领域内,通过编程(Python语言)来进行数据分析越来越流行,这就是一个比较明显的发展信号 。未来不仅是互联网行业 , 更多传统行业的企业将逐渐成为数据驱动型的企业,而这个过程必然会伴随着知识结构的升级,编程是其中的重要内容之一 。2、辅助学习 。随着大数据技术的发展,未来的学习过程将更加智能化,更多的智能体将以教育的形式走进人们的生活中,而编程语言是与这些智能体进行交流的重要方式之一,所以掌握编程语言对于学习也是有重要意义的 。3、方便生活 。随着5G的落地应用 , 未来在生活场景中会有越来越多可编程的智能体,掌握编程技术可以更加方便的按照自己的需求进行各种个性化的设定,比如对智能家居产品和智能汽车产品进行编程等等 。想了解更多有关编程的详情,推荐咨询达内教育 。达内教育独创TTS8.0教学系统,达内OMO教学模式,全新升级 , 线上线下交互学习,满足学生多样化学习需求;同时,拥有经验丰富的讲师进行课程的讲授 , 对标企业人才标准,制定专业学习计划 , 囊括主流热点技术,运用理论知识+学习思维+实战操作,打造完整学习闭环;更有企业双选会,让学生就业更顺利 。感兴趣的话点击此处,免费学习一下5,用语言编写的程序执行速度快机器语言是硬件能接受的直接的语言,所以使用机器语言的运行最快,但对于编写程序来说,没有人会喜欢使用101001这样的行使去些吧,汇编语言是直接对于地址进行操作的 , 相对于别的语言来说,速度要快,但是和机器语言比,就逊色了 。其他的语言再运行前都要进行编译的,编译的过程就是对语言到机器语言的转换 , 所以其他语言要低于汇编和机器语言 。语言的快慢对于程序来说是次要的,选择好好的算法,要比选择语言重要 。程序执行速度最快的是汇编语言,汇编语言写的程序执行效率高,体积小 , 一般用与开发底层大型系统 。机器语言:就是用0和1,绝对最高效 , 能实现任何功能 汇编语言:mov jum push pop add sum 。。编程难度大,但很高效,能实现任何功能 c/c++/c.net三种语言:他们比汇编次 , 但是容易写,简单,能实现大多功能 , 效率可以 java,delphi,vb 。。:都是可视化编程,属于应用型,效率低,简单易学 , 大多程序员都用他们6,执行速度最快的编程语言是什么执行速度最快的编程语言是:机器语言 。机器语言是机器能直接识别的程序语言或指令代码,勿需经过翻译,每一操作码在计算机内部都有相应的电路来完成它,或指不经翻译即可为机器直接理解和接受的程序语言或指令代码 。它具有灵活、直接执行和速度快等特点 。扩展资料机器语言具有灵活、直接执行和速度快等特点 。不同型号的计算机其机器语言是不相通的,按着一种计算机的机器指令编制的程序 , 不能在另一种计算机上执行 。一条指令就是机器语言的一个语句,它是一组有意义的二进制代码 。用机器语言编写程序 , 编程人员要首先熟记所用计算机的全部指令代码和代码的涵义 。手编程序时,程序员得自己处理每条指令和每一数据的存储分配和输入输出,还得记住编程过程中每步所使用的工作单元处在何种状态 。-机器语言 。机器语言为机器能直接识别的程序语言或指令代码 , 无需经过翻译,每一操作码在计算机内部都有相应的电路来完成它,或指不经翻译即可为机器直接理解和接受的程序语言或指令代码 。机器语言使用绝对地址和绝对操作码 。不同的计算机都有各自的机器语言,即指令系统 。从使用的角度看,机器语言是最低级的语言 。扩展资料机器语言有如下特点:1、机器语言与计算机硬件结构密切相关不同的计算机硬件结构有着不同的机器语言 , 在以CPU为核心的计算机硬件结构中,不同CPU有着不同的机器语言,机器语言与计算机硬件结构密切相关 。2、二进制数表示机器语言中,指令操作码、存放操作数的存储单元的地址、操作数等都用二进制数表示 , CPU将以程序计数器的值为地址访问存储器读到的内容作为指令,以指令中给出的操作数地址 。或以地址寄存器B的值为地址访问存储器读到的内容作为操作数 。由CPU负责区分指令和操作数 , 表示指令和操作数的二进制数本身是无法区分二者的 。3、设计程序时需同步安排指令和操作数在存储器中的存放位置由于运算指令需要指定存放另一个操作数的存储单元的地址,控制指令需要指定不顺序执行指令的情况下,存放另一段程序或循环体中第一条指令的存储单元的地址,因此,设计程序过程也是安排指令和操作数在存储器中存放位置的过程 。4、每一条指令只能完成简单运算功能机器语言的每一条指令只能完成简单的运算功能 。用机器语言编写完成复杂运算过程的程序是比较困难的,一个完成只包含四则运算表达式的运算过程的机器语言程序都是比较复杂的 。可以尝试用模型机机器指令编写完成表达式:7*8+(21—1 7)*5一(7+21)÷6运算过程的机器语言程序 。参考资料来源:百度百科-基本机器语言参考资料来源:百度百科-机器语言最快的是机器码啊,全是10, 可以做到一条废指令都没有 。其次是汇编指令,基本上和机器吗可以一一映射,再其次是汇编语言, 再其次是c 。操作硬件还是软件 术业有专攻 。汇编语言 。其次是C语言 , 一般比汇编语言慢20%-30%近水楼台先得月,执行速度越快的程序越靠近底层,譬如汇编,c,c++这个速度只是从总体上来说的,如果某个同样功能的程序用不同语言编写,其执行的速度不一定的 。这就要看执行的环境和程序本身的执行效率了,没有不好的语言,只有不会玩的人 。

    推荐阅读